Aleksandar Stamboliyski

Bulgarian prime minister (1879-1923)

Aleksandar Stamboliyski (March 1, 1879June 14, 1923) was the prime minister of Bulgaria from 1919 until 1923. He was a member of the Agrarian Union, an agrarian peasant movement which was not allied to the monarchy, and edited their newspaper. Opposed to the country's participation in World War I and its support for the Central Powers, he was court-martialed and sentenced to life in prison in 1915. He was a supporter of the idea of a Balkan federation and identified not as a Bulgarian, but as a South Slav.
